An Ethereum wallet is the first step to getting started with the Ethereum ecosystem. It is like an online account on the Ethereum blockchain, allowing users to trade or hold Ether, the native token of the network, as well as to interact with other products and services in the ecosystem.
Since Ethereum is decentralized, some might assume that creating an ETH wallet may require technical knowledge. However, the process of setting up an Ethereum wallet is pretty straightforward, even as easy as installing software on your PC or mobile device.
Key Takeaways
- An Ethereum wallet acts as a gateway to the Ethereum ecosystem.
- There are different types of ETH wallets, each with its own upsides and downsides.
- Factors like security, control, and accessibility are important when choosing an ETH wallet.
- Creating an Ethereum wallet usually involves generating a key pair.
- Ethereum wallets typically have high-security standards.
What is an Ethereum Wallet?
An Ethereum wallet is like an online account that acts as a gateway to the Ethereum ecosystem. At its core, it enables users to store, trade, and use Ethereum-based assets like ERC-20 tokens and non-fungible tokens (NFTs).
An ETH wallet is also necessary for those who want to interact with decentralized applications (DApps) and smart contracts built on the Ethereum platform.
Which Ethereum Wallet Should I Choose?
There are different types of ETH wallets, each with its own upsides and downsides. Software wallets, hardware wallets, paper wallets, and extension wallets are the most popular ones.
5 Factors for Choosing the Right Type of Ethereum Wallet
Here are 5 factors to consider when choosing the right type of Ethereum wallet:
Security is naturally the most important factor in choosing an ETH wallet. A wallet that has security measures like two-factor authentication, multi-signature support, and backup options should naturally be a preferred choice. Hardware wallets are generally the most secure due to their offline nature.
Users need to consider whether they prefer a non-custodial wallet, which gives them complete control over their assets, or a custodial service that manages them for them.
This factor is specifically important for users who wish to trade more often and be able to send and receive transactions on the move. Software wallets offer the best accessibility.
The wallet should come with an intuitive, user-friendly interface.
Users need to consider whether the Ethereum wallet supports the tokens they want to manage and is compatible with the services they intend to use.
How to Create an Ethereum Wallet
The first step in creating an Ethereum wallet is to choose a wallet type that best fits your needs. No matter which type of wallet you choose, the next step is to generate a key pair, which includes a private key and a public key.
A private key, also known as a secret key, is used to authorize transactions and prove ownership. On the other hand, a public key is a cryptographic code used to generate addresses that allow a user to receive cryptocurrencies.
Most wallets also provide you with a secret recovery phrase, which is a vital backup for accessing your funds in case you lose the private key.
3 Steps to Create an Ethereum Software Wallet
Here is how to create a software Ethereum wallet in 3 simple steps:
Install wallet
Naturally, the first step is to download and install the software wallet.Create a new wallet
Once installed, open the software wallet and follow the on-screen instructions. This typically involves setting a strong password and storing the private key and recovery phrase.Log in to wallet
After setting up the wallet and receiving your private key and recovery phrase, you will be able to log in to the wallet and start transacting.
6 Steps to Create an Ethereum Hardware Wallet
You can create an Ethereum hardware wallet in these 6 simple steps:
Buy a hardware wallet
Connect hardware wallet to computer
Create ETH wallet
Choose “Set up a new device” to generate new private keys and to create a new account.Set up device
Your hardware wallet will also need a password. For instance, users can choose a 4 to 8-digit PIN code for their Ledger device.Save recovery phrase
The next step is to save or restore your 24-word recovery phrase. Your recovery phrase backs up the private keys that manage your crypto assets. It can be used to restore access to your crypto assets in case you lose access to your device.Start transacting
The final step is to start receiving transactions. To do this, simply provide your ETH address, which can be found within the wallet’s interface.
5 Steps to Create an Ethereum Paper Wallet
Paper wallets can be suitable for users who prefer added security without spending money on a hardware wallet.
Here’s how to set up a paper wallet:
Choose a paper wallet generator
To create a paper wallet, you need to choose a paper wallet generator. One option is MyEtherWallet, an Ethereum paper wallet generator.Download app
After choosing a wallet provider, download its app.Generate paper wallet
Open the app and follow the instructions to generate a paper wallet.Print paper wallet
Once generated, print the paper wallet, which typically includes a public address for receiving funds and a private key for accessing and managing those funds.Making transcations
When you need to access the funds in your wallet, you can import the private key into a digital wallet or a suitable client to make transactions.
5 Steps to Creating Ethereum Wallet Extension
Here is how to make an Ethereum wallet extension:
Download browser extension
Open the wallet’s official web page and download its browser extension. MetaMask is the most popular extension wallet.Create a new wallet
Once installed, open the extension wallet and follow the instructions to create a new wallet.Import wallet
If you already have one, you will also have the option to import that wallet using your secret recovery phrase.Store recovery phrase
Next, you’ll be presented with your recovery phrase or wallet seed phrase. This is your super secret password which provides access to your wallet.Find address
You may find your Ethereum address, which starts with “0x,” on the platform and use it for receiving funds.
Ethereum Wallet Safety
Ethereum wallets typically have high-security standards. There are very few instances of a wallet provider being hacked. Instead, most of the time users lose their funds stored in a wallet because of their own fault.
Therefore, to enhance the security of their wallets, users must never share their recovery phrase with anyone. They also need to be careful of phishing attempts and save a backup in multiple places.
The Bottom Line
An Ethereum wallet is like an online account that acts as a gateway to the Ethereum ecosystem. It can be used to store digital assets as well as to interact with DeFi applications and smart contracts.
Software wallets, hardware wallets, paper wallets, and extension wallets are the most popular types of ETH wallets. To choose one that best fits your needs, you need to consider factors like security, control, and accessibility.